The computer as a learning tool for preschoolers

February 25, 2009
In today's world the computer and appropriate software can be used to enhance the early childhood education curriculum. There are countless programs on the Internet as well as off the shelf programs available for this purpose. These  programs are interactive and give verbal instructions to kids, who at this age, cannot read as yet. These programs present topics such as the alphabet, colors, shapes and numbers etc in a manner that is fun, exciting and stimulating for young minds. As a result kids learn what is taught at a faster rate.
 

When should kids start using the computer?

February 24, 2009
My daughter started using the computer at age three and a half. She uses mainly educational software available on the Internet as well as educational CDs that I purchased. Since then she has shown steady improvement in mouse control skill, listening comprehension, speaking and even word recognition.
